from a writing by Olga M. (Jahnke) Wiebe
"Four months after I married Herbert Wiebe he became mayor of Herbert. I was only twenty-two years old and he was mayor all but one year of our married life. ...
During the dirty thirties the town council experienced many difficulties. Their meetings were often long and the work arduous. This meant I was alone a lot. In 1939 the Second World War broke out and my husband became a lieutenant officer in the Herbert reserve army. This activity created more hours away from home."

Jack Wiebe, son of Herb Wiebe, former Mayor of Herbert, grandson of John F.D. Wiebe, first Mayor of Herbert, served as Lieutenant Governor of Province of Saskatchewan from May 31, 1994 to February 16, 2000.

From April 6, 2000 to January 31, 2004 he served as a Senator in Government of Canada, Ottawa.

He and his wife have retired to Swift Current, Saskatchewan, 30 miles from Herbert. They are still members of the Herbert United Church.
